What is FPY?

First Pass Yield (FPY) is a quality metric that measures the percentage of products or services produced without any defects or rework in the first attempt. In Indian manufacturing, IT services, and BPO sectors, FPY is a critical key performance indicator (KPI) that reflects process efficiency and quality control. It is calculated by dividing the number of units completed defect-free on the first pass by the total number of units started. A higher FPY indicates lower waste, reduced costs, and better customer satisfaction. FPY is widely used in lean manufacturing and Six Sigma initiatives across Indian factories, automotive plants, and software development firms. FPY — frequently asked questions

What is the full form of FPY?
FPY stands for First Pass Yield. It is a quality metric that measures the percentage of units produced without any defects or rework in the first processing attempt.
How is FPY calculated?
FPY is calculated by dividing the number of units completed defect-free on the first pass by the total number of units started, then multiplying by 100 to get a percentage.
Why is FPY important for Indian manufacturers?
FPY helps Indian manufacturers reduce waste, lower production costs, improve customer satisfaction, and meet quality standards for domestic and export markets, especially in automotive and electronics sectors.
